Description
The Silvretta High-Altitude Trail Long stretches over 4 kilometres, making it the longest loop on the Bielerhöhe. Starting at the Silvrettahaus, the course initially descends gently before a mild climb brings you back to the starting point. This intermediate trail offers stunning views of the Silvretta Reservoir, surrounding glaciers, and the high-alpine landscape. It connects seamlessly with the smaller High-Altitude Trails and the Dam Trail.
With the railway station in Landeck, the Paznaun is optimally connected to the Austrian train network. From Landeck-Zams station, only a short bus ride separates you from the Paznaun. Every half hour, line bus 260 runs from there through the valley. Bus stop: Wirl/Birkhahnbahn
